A New Sohaer:

 

Mali'aheral must now nominate themselves and other mali'aheral for the position of Soaher. Speeches regarding why said mali'aheral are qualified are a must. In precisely 2 elven days nominations will be closed and the election will begin.

 

 

Duties of the Sohaer

 

1.) Consultation.  While the Sohaer presides as the head of state, he or she is obliged to seek the advice of fellow authorities.  The two underlings who share seats of power should be sought out before large decisions are made, to better inform the wisdom of the Sohaer himself/herself.

2.) Status.  The Sohaer claims the right to differentiate between times of war and times of peace.  Without a stated declaration from the Sohaer, the City cannot engage in national conflict.

3.) Diplomacy.  The friendships of our Nation are tied directly to Her fate.  Thus, in the Sohaer rests the ability to choose our state’s official allies and enemies.  No tie between our nation and another can be made without the approval of the Sohaer. Also, the Sohaer conducts visits from emissaries and representatives from alien nations.  All inquiries on the national level by diplomatic meeting are to be attended by the Sohaer.

4.) Guidance.  Referendums must be signed into the law by the Sohaer.  Ratification of law is vested in the signatory of this position.

5.) Teaching The Sohaer must be knowledgeable about all matters of the City and Mali’aheral culture.  More importantly, however, he or she must teach these things to all who inquire it, so as to enhance the Blessed City’s wealth and blessing in knowledge.

6.) Service.  The Sohaer must be at the service of the city, with no task for the betterment of all below himself/herself.  The Sohaer shall perform any task for the advancement and health of the Mali’aheral beneath his or her power.

7.) Example.  More than anything, the Sohaer shall represent the best aspects of all Mali’aheral and serve as a role-model for all. With exceptional purity, and exceptional citizenship, the Sohaer must demonstrate for each citizen the pinnacle of Mali’aheral expectation for behaviour.
